Abstract(in English) We have made a prototype system of communication that can provide real-time handwriting conversation between plural clients via the internet. The system uses HTTP for communication and the data are vectorized in time-sequence, resulting in having information commonly between clients. Even stroke orders of written data are reproduced in the clients' windows, so writing conversation with accurate notification of writer's will becomes realized.
